round them up


Meanings
  • Phrasal verb (transitive)

    To gather or bring together a group of people or things.

    - "The police rounded up the suspects and took them to the station."
    - "The teacher asked the students to round up their belongings and prepare for recess."

Etymology
origin and the way in which meanings have changed throughout history.

The phrase 'round up' originated from the practice of gathering cattle or sheep by driving them into a circular enclosure. It has been used figuratively since the late 1800s.
